Nermin Karahan is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Nermin Karahan has authored 69 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Surgery, 11 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 9 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Nermin Karahan's work include Endometriosis Research and Treatment (6 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(5 papers) and Reproductive System and Pregnancy (5 papers). Nermin Karahan is often cited by papers focused on Endometriosis Research and Treatment (6 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(5 papers) and Reproductive System and Pregnancy (5 papers). Nermin Karahan collaborates with scholars based in Türkiye, Kazakhstan and Singapore. Nermin Karahan's co-authors include Tamer Mungan, Baha Oral, Mehmet Güney, Namık Delibaş, Nilgün Kapucuoğlu, Fehmi Özgüner, Şirin Başpınar, İbrahim Metin Çiriş, İrfan Altuntaş and Sema Bircan and has published in prestigious journals such as Fertility and Sterility, Journal of Periodontology and Arthroscopy The Journal of Arthroscopic and Related Surgery.
